Intervention Service Frequently Asked Questions
How do I know if my teen needs an intervention?
Consider an intervention if your teen exhibits persistent substance use despite negative consequences, denies having a problem, refuses to discuss treatment options, or if previous attempts to address the issue have failed. Interventions are particularly helpful when traditional conversations haven’t produced change.
Will an intervention make my teenager hate our family?
When properly conducted by professionals, interventions actually strengthen family bonds rather than damage them. Our approach emphasizes expressing love and concern rather than anger or blame. Many teens later express gratitude for the intervention that helped them accept treatment.
What happens if my teen refuses treatment during the intervention?
Our interventionists are trained to handle resistance and have multiple strategies to overcome objections. However, if refusal persists, we help families establish clear boundaries and consequences. We also provide ongoing support and can attempt the intervention again when circumstances change.
Can we conduct an intervention without professional help?
While families sometimes attempt interventions on their own, success rates are significantly lower without professional guidance. Adolescents are particularly skilled at manipulating family dynamics, and emotions can quickly derail unprofessional interventions. Our specialists provide the structure and expertise needed for success.
Are interventions for adolescents different from those for adults?
Adolescent interventions require specialized approaches that account for teen developmental stages, communication styles, and unique resistance patterns. Our interventionists understand adolescent psychology and use age-appropriate techniques that resonate with young people while respecting their emerging autonomy.
How do we prepare for an intervention?
Preparation is crucial for a successful intervention. Our specialists will guide your family through collecting specific examples of concerning behaviors, practicing clear and compassionate communication, anticipating potential reactions, and establishing appropriate boundaries. We’ll also help determine who should participate and ensure everyone understands their role in the process.
Will other people know about our family's intervention?
Confidentiality is a cornerstone of our intervention services. We understand the sensitivity surrounding adolescent substance use and maintain strict privacy protocols. Your family’s situation will only be shared with the treatment professionals directly involved in your teen’s care.
Can interventions work for teens who are using multiple substances?
Yes, our intervention approach is effective regardless of the substance(s) your teen is using. Whether dealing with alcohol, marijuana, prescription medications, or other drugs, the intervention process addresses the underlying patterns of use and denial rather than focusing solely on specific substances.
